However, there are some DIY fixes that must not be attempted. A broken, dripping roof is one of the most feared house repairs since finding and correcting a leak isn’t generally uncomplicated.
Discolored or drooping sheetrock, flaking paint, or an evident drip are all signs of a roof leak. Even a small undiscovered leak can trigger damaged insulation, mildew advancement, and decayed wood structure. A leak can also move and spread out from the original damaged area to another part of your home.

Your roof will never ever have a bad day, yet aging is inevitable. All roofing products are prone to severe climate condition such as rainstorms, freeze/thaw cycles, heats, and intense summertime sun, which might ultimately cause premature aging, cracking, and curling of the shingles.
Brick chimneys seem strong, however the mortar that holds the bricks together, along with the flashing and chimney crown, can be easily damaged. Water may get into the attic through fractures, corrosion, and punctures.
A leak can be readily caused by missing out on or broken shingles. Private shingle replacement is typically not a significant concern, however failing to get it repaired may lead to more broken shingles and more costly repairs.
The vents on your roof system include exposed fasteners that will fracture, deteriorate, and age gradually. This is a little repair, however it is a common source of leakages because most vents do not last the life of the roof.
The plumbing boot slips over a pipeline to secure the pipe’s connection to the roof. The boot, like the vents and flashing, can be harmed, fracture, and stop working. The repair isn’t particularly hard, although damage can be easily neglected.
Storm damage, strong winds, and hail might all cause large and little holes. Some holes appear, however others might go undiscovered for years up until an evaluation exposes them. Water can enter through even small holes triggered by misplaced roofing nails, the elimination of an antenna or dish mounting bracket, or impact-related cracks in roofing materials.
A complex, convoluted roofline might be quite appealing, but it is also harder to waterproof. Every joint, valley, and slope must be marked.
Roof products battle to stand up to freeze-thaw cycles, along with ice and snow. Water may slip into microscopic areas between and under shingles when snow collects, melts, and refreezes. Water swells and deepens the fracture as it freezes. The weight of the snow and ice can also cause flexing and drooping of the flashing and plywood structure.
Seamless gutters may posture troubles if they are not cleaned and fixed on a regular basis. Rainwater can support behind a clog and permeate through the shingles, harming the wood underneath. Standing water can likewise cause harm to older seamless gutters.
Skylights, like chimneys and pipeline vents, have some of the same concerns. Aside from potential flashing damage, the rubber or vinyl seals around skylights may dry up and fracture; at this point, the skylight must be replaced.
Wetness can build up in your attic as a result of ventilation problems, and this can simulate a roof leak. In order to sufficiently leave warm air and wetness from your attic area, your roof needs to have sufficient consumption and exhaust ventilation. This can result in wood rot, mold, and harmed insulation, and it has the prospective to be a very pricey repair.
The greatest protection against roof leaks is to schedule a yearly roof inspection and to act quickly if you suspect a leak.

Understanding for how long to install a brand-new roofing really is a concern of understanding how well took care of your current roofing is. Numerous new roofing systems featured a life of approximately 20 years and some more long lasting and hard using roofings will have a life as long as 40 or 50 years however if you do not care for your roofing system and regularly have it examined and preserved you deal with an extremely genuine risk of significantly reducing this life-span. When you have a brand-new roof fitted you should, as far as possible, pay as much as you can pay for to ensure that you get as long a life as possible with your brand-new roofing.
Taking the plunge.
Everything depends on the size of the roofing system, the shape of the roofing system and precisely what you are having actually fitted. Applying a single layer of shingles on an existing roof is not likely to take longer than a couple of days but having your existing roofing entirely eliminated and a completely brand-new one built can take a number of weeks. Do be mindful that things can go wrong and even when there is nothing incorrect with the roofing system a sudden modification in the weather condition can set the building and construction of your new roofing system back dramatically.
Start as you mean to go on.
Due to the fact that it comes with a ten-year service warranty you won't require to do anything about upkeep for the very first ten years, once you have your brand-new roof fitted you shouldn't simply presume that. You should, wherever possible, have a yearly check up simply to make sure that whatever is ok since if a small problem is discovered it can be repaired prior to the little problem becomes a much larger and more expensive problem.
